For increased … WebMay 24, 2014 · Always carry patients head first up the stairs and feet first down the stairs. Try to use a stair chair if the patient's condition allows it. If a stair chair is not available, use a light but sturdy kitchen chair. If neither are available, use the extremity lift. Keep you back in the locked-in position.

Grip the elbows, pressing them against the victim's head to support it. fisheries nsw careersWebThe advantage of the Swing or Chair Carry is that partners can support, with practice and coordination, a person whose weights is the same or even greater than their own eight. The disadvantage is increased awkwardness in vertical travel (stair descent) due to the complexity of the two-person carry. ...
